| /** |
| * The splash screen image scale mode: |
| * |
| * <ul> |
| * <li>A value of <code>none</code> implies that the image size is set |
| * to match its intrinsic size.</li> |
| * |
| * <li>A value of <code>stretch</code> sets the width and the height of the image to the |
| * stage width and height, possibly changing the content aspect ratio.</li> |
| * |
| * <li>A value of <code>letterbox</code> sets the width and height of the image |
| * as close to the stage width and height as possible while maintaining aspect ratio. |
| * The image is stretched to a maximum of the stage bounds, |
| * with spacing added inside the stage to maintain the aspect ratio if necessary.</li> |
| * |
| * <li>A value of <code>zoom</code> is similar to <code>letterbox</code>, except |
| * that <code>zoom</code> stretches the image past the bounds of the stage, |
| * to remove the spacing required to maintain aspect ratio. |
| * This setting has the effect of using the entire bounds of the stage, but also |
| * possibly cropping some of the image.</li> |
| * </ul> |
| * |
| * <p>The portion of the stage that is not covered by the image shows |
| * in the Application container's <code>backgroundColor</code>.</p> |
| * |
| * <p><b>Note:</b> The property has effect only when the <code>splashScreenImage</code> property |
| * is set and the <code>preloader</code> property is set to spark.preloaders.SplashScreen. |
| * The spark.preloaders.SplashScreen class is the default preloader for Mobile Flex applications. |
| * This property cannot be set by ActionScript code; it must be set in MXML code.</p> |
| * |
| * <p><b>Note:</b> You must add the frameworks\libs\mobile\mobilecomponents.swc to the |
| * library path of the application to support the splash screen in a desktop application.</p> |
| * |
| * @default "none" |
| * @see #splashScreenImage |
| * @see #splashScreenMinimumDisplayTime |
| * |
| * @langversion 3.0 |
| * @playerversion Flash 10 |
| * @playerversion AIR 2.5 |
| * @productversion Flex 4.5 |
| */ |
| public var splashScreenScaleMode:String; |

| /** |
| * A class that extends RuntimeDPIProvider and overrides the default Flex |
| * calculations for <code>runtimeDPI</code>. |
| * |
| * <p>Flex's default mappings are: |
| * <table class="innertable"> |
| * <tr><td>160 DPI</td><td><140 DPI</td></tr> |
| * <tr><td>160 DPI</td><td>>=140 DPI and <=200 DPI</td></tr> |
| * <tr><td>240 DPI</td><td>>=200 DPI and <=280 DPI</td></tr> |
| * <tr><td>320 DPI</td><td>>=280 DPI and <=400 DPI</td></tr> |
| * <tr><td>480 DPI</td><td>>=400 DPI and <=560 DPI</td></tr> |
| * <tr><td>640 DPI</td><td>>=640 DPI</td></tr> |
| * </table> |
| * </p> |
| * |
| * This property cannot be set by ActionScript code; it must be set in MXML code. |
| * |
| * @default spark.components.RuntimeDPIProvider |
| * |
| * @see #applicationDPI |
| * @see #runtimeDPI |
| * @see mx.core.DPIClassification |
| * @see mx.core.RuntimeDPIProvider |
| * |
| * @langversion 3.0 |
| * @playerversion AIR 2.5 |
| * @productversion Flex 4.5 |
| */ |

| /** |
| * @private |
| * This is the event handler for the stage's orientationChanging event. It |
| * cancels the orientation animation and manually swaps the width and height |
| * of the application to allow the application to validate itself before |
| * the orientation change occurs. The orientaitonChanging is only listened |
| * for on iOS devices. |
| */ |
| private function stage_orientationChangingHandler(event:Event):void |
| { |
| var sm:ISystemManager = systemManager; |
| |
| // Manually update orientation width and height if the application's explicit |
| // sizes aren't set. If they are, we assume the application will handle |
| // orientation on their own. |
| // SDK-30625: check stage for null since the Application may not be on-screen yet |
| // if orientation changes during start-up. |
| if (!stage || !isNaN(explicitWidth) || !isNaN(explicitHeight)) |
| return; |
| |
| if (!cachedDimensions) |
| cachedDimensions = new Dictionary(); |
| |
| // remember the current dimensions |
| previousWidth = width; |
| previousHeight = height; |
| |
| var key:String = width + ":" + height; |
| |
| // On some platforms (e.g. iOS and Playbook) if the soft keyboard is up |
| // it deactivates before orientation change and reactivates after it; |
| // the value of isSoftKeyboardActive thus changes during orientation change. |
| // We are remembering the initial value of isSoftKeyboardActivate in this |
| // situation for use in avoiding excessive resizing during the orientation change. |
| keyboardActiveInOrientationChange = isSoftKeyboardActive; |
| |
| // if we're rotating 180 degrees don't do any screen resizing |
| var beforeOrientation:String = event["beforeOrientation"]; |
| var afterOrientation:String = event["afterOrientation"]; |
| |
| if ((beforeOrientation == "default" && afterOrientation == "upsideDown") || |
| (beforeOrientation == "upsideDown" && afterOrientation == "default") || |
| (beforeOrientation == "rotatedLeft" && afterOrientation == "rotatedRight") || |
| (beforeOrientation == "rotatedRight" && afterOrientation == "rotatedLeft")) |
| return; |
| |
| var newWidth:Number; |
| var newHeight:Number; |
| |
| // if we have a cached value, use it |
| if (cachedDimensions[key]) |
| { |
| newWidth = cachedDimensions[key].width; |
| newHeight = cachedDimensions[key].height; |
| } |
| else // no cached value; just swap the numbers for now |
| { |
| // use stageHeight as the new width if you can get it |
| newWidth = stage ? stage.stageHeight / scaleFactor : height; |
| newHeight = width; |
| } |
| |
| setActualSize(newWidth, newHeight); |
| |
| // Indicate that the width and height have changed because of orientation |
| explicitSizingForOrientation = true; |
| |
| // Force a validation |
| validateNow(); |
| } |

| /** |
| * @private |
| * Sets the new width and height after the Stage has resized |
| * or when percentHeight or percentWidth has changed. |
| */ |
| private function updateBounds():void |
| { |
| // When user has not specified any width/height, |
| // application assumes the size of the stage. |
| // If developer has specified width/height, |
| // the application will not resize. |
| // If developer has specified percent width/height, |
| // application will resize to the required value |
| // based on the current SystemManager's width/height. |
| // If developer has specified min/max values, |
| // then application will not resize beyond those values. |
| |
| // ignore updateBounds while orientation is changing |
| if (keyboardActiveInOrientationChange) |
| return; |
| |
| var w:Number; |
| var h:Number |
| |
| if (resizeWidth) |
| { |
| if (isNaN(percentWidth)) |
| { |
| w = DisplayObject(systemManager).width; |
| } |
| else |
| { |
| super.percentWidth = Math.max(percentWidth, 0); |
| super.percentWidth = Math.min(percentWidth, 100); |
| w = percentWidth*DisplayObject(systemManager).width/100; |
| } |
| |
| if (!isNaN(explicitMaxWidth)) |
| w = Math.min(w, explicitMaxWidth); |
| |
| if (!isNaN(explicitMinWidth)) |
| w = Math.max(w, explicitMinWidth); |
| } |
| else |
| { |
| w = width; |
| } |
| |
| if (resizeHeight) |
| { |
| if (isNaN(percentHeight)) |
| { |
| h = DisplayObject(systemManager).height; |
| } |
| else |
| { |
| super.percentHeight = Math.max(percentHeight, 0); |
| super.percentHeight = Math.min(percentHeight, 100); |
| h = percentHeight*DisplayObject(systemManager).height/100; |
| } |
| |
| if (!isNaN(explicitMaxHeight)) |
| h = Math.min(h, explicitMaxHeight); |
| |
| if (!isNaN(explicitMinHeight)) |
| h = Math.max(h, explicitMinHeight); |
| } |
| else |
| { |
| h = height; |
| } |
| |
| if (w != width || h != height) |
| { |
| invalidateProperties(); |
| invalidateSize(); |
| } |
| |
| setActualSize(w, h); |
| |
| invalidateDisplayList(); |
| } |
